Install Security Cameras

A Safe Home

A home security camera system can be an excellent investment to make your home safer. Not only do they allow you to keep an eye on your property while you’re away, but they can also deter criminals from even attempting a break-in. One study found that homes with security cameras were 60% less likely to be burglarized than homes without them. But how do you know which security camera system is right for your home?

There are a few things to consider, such as budget, installation, and monitoring. Once you’ve decided on a system, installing the cameras is next. You can do this yourself if you’re handy, or you can hire a professional. Either way, ensuring your cameras are installed properly is crucial to keeping your home safe.

Create A Fire Safety Plan

A Safe Home

In the event of a fire, every second counts. That’s why it’s so important to have a fire safety plan to ensure everyone in your home knows what to do. The first step is to identify all potential exits from each room. If possible, you should also have at least two designated meeting points outside the home where everyone can gather in the event of an emergency. Once your escape routes are mapped out, it’s time to start thinking about how you will actually get out of the house if there is a fire.

If you have small children or pets, you may want to invest in a ladder that they can use to escape from second-story windows. You should also ensure that everyone in your household knows how to use a fire extinguisher. Finally, it’s important to practice your fire safety plan regularly so that everyone knows what to do in the event of an emergency. By taking these simple steps, you can help keep your family safe in the event of a fire.
